fix(codex): infer image capability for generated catalogs and resync takeover live on save

Mapped GPT models were rejected by Codex clients with "model does not
support image inputs". Two root causes:

- Catalog entries for native-Responses/Anthropic providers cloned a
  template whose input_modalities defaulted to ["text"], so every mapped
  model was advertised text-only. model_catalog_json replaces Codex's
  built-in model table wholesale, and both the TUI and the IDE extension
  block images pre-send when the current model is found without "image".
- Editing the current Codex provider during proxy takeover only refreshed
  the DB backup, so removing the mapping left a stale model_catalog_json
  pointer (and its text-only catalog file) active in live config.

Changes:

- New shared model_capabilities module: explicit row declaration first,
  then a confirmed text-only registry (exact tail match only — prefix
  matching removed, variants enumerated so future -vl/-vision models fail
  open), everything else unknown.
- Catalog generation writes input_modalities from that inference for all
  tool profiles: unknown models fail open to ["text","image"]; only
  confirmed text-only models are advertised as ["text"], giving users a
  clear client-side prompt instead of silent image stripping.
- Live catalog reverse-import collapses modalities that match current
  inference, so registry corrections are not frozen into hidden row
  overrides and the rectifier's heuristic opt-out keeps working.
- Saving the current Codex provider while takeover owns live now
  re-projects the live config (mirrors the hot-switch path), so mapping
  edits and removals take effect immediately.
- Media rectifier delegates to the shared module; its preflight toggle is
  documented (4 locales) as proxy-request-only, never affecting catalog
  capability declarations.
